Description | Traceback (most recent call last):
File "/usr/bin/mitmproxy", line 2, in <module>
from libmproxy.main import mitmproxy
File "/usr/lib/python2.7/dist-packages/libmproxy/main.py", line 6, in <module>
from . import version, cmdline
File "/usr/lib/python2.7/dist-packages/libmproxy/cmdline.py", line 6, in <module>
from . import filt, utils, version
File "/usr/lib/python2.7/dist-packages/libmproxy/filt.py", line 37, in <module>
from .protocol.http import decoded
File "/usr/lib/python2.7/dist-packages/libmproxy/protocol/init.py", line 1, in <module>
from .primitives import *
File "/usr/lib/python2.7/dist-packages/libmproxy/protocol/primitives.py", line 4, in <module>
import netlib.tcp
File "/usr/local/lib/python2.7/dist-packages/netlib/tcp.py", line 8, in <module>
from OpenSSL import SSL
File "/usr/lib/python2.7/dist-packages/OpenSSL/init.py", line 8, in <module>
from OpenSSL import rand, crypto, SSL
File "/usr/lib/python2.7/dist-packages/OpenSSL/rand.py", line 11, in <module>
from OpenSSL._util import (
File "/usr/lib/python2.7/dist-packages/OpenSSL/_util.py", line 3, in <module>
from cryptography.hazmat.bindings.openssl.binding import Binding
File "/usr/local/lib/python2.7/dist-packages/cryptography/hazmat/bindings/openssl/binding.py", line 60, in <module>
class Binding(object):
File "/usr/local/lib/python2.7/dist-packages/cryptography/hazmat/bindings/openssl/binding.py", line 108, in Binding
libraries=_get_libraries(sys.platform)
File "/usr/local/lib/python2.7/dist-packages/cryptography/hazmat/bindings/utils.py", line 97, in build_ffi_for_binding
extra_link_args=extra_link_args,
File "/usr/local/lib/python2.7/dist-packages/cryptography/hazmat/bindings/utils.py", line 105, in build_ffi
ffi = FFI()
File "/usr/local/lib/python2.7/dist-packages/cffi/api.py", line 58, in init
assert backend.version == version
AssertionError |
---|
Additional Information | I reported a bug before that was fixed today with python-configrparse
Reading package lists... Done
Reading package lists... Done
Building dependency tree
Reading state information... Done
0 upgraded, 0 newly installed, 0 to remove and 1 not upgraded.
2 not fully installed or removed.
After this operation, 0 B of additional disk space will be used.
Setting up python-configargparse (0.9.3-0kali1) ...
SyntaxError: ('invalid syntax', ('/usr/lib/python2.6/dist-packages/configargparse.py', 16, 65, 'ACTION_TYPES_THAT_DONT_NEED_A_VALUE = {argparse._StoreTrueAction,\n'))
dpkg: error processing python-configargparse (--configure):
subprocess installed post-installation script returned error exit status 101
dpkg: dependency problems prevent configuration of mitmproxy:
mitmproxy depends on python-configargparse (>= 0.9.3); however:
Package python-configargparse is not configured yet.
dpkg: error processing mitmproxy (--configure):
dependency problems - leaving unconfigured
Errors were encountered while processing:
python-configargparse
mitmproxy
E: Sub-process /usr/bin/dpkg returned an error code (1) |
---|